The Crucial Role of N-Methyl-N-hydroxyethyl-p-toluidine in Organic Synthesis
In the intricate world of organic chemistry, the selection of the right intermediates is paramount to the success of any synthesis. Among these essential building blocks, N-Methyl-N-hydroxyethyl-p-toluidine (CAS 2842-44-6) stands out due to its unique chemical structure and versatility. As a key compound manufactured by leading chemical companies in China, it plays a crucial role in a myriad of synthetic pathways.
The demand for high-purity N-Methyl-N-hydroxyethyl-p-toluidine stems from its utility as an organic synthesis intermediate. Its molecular formula, C10H15NO, and structure, featuring a tertiary amine and a hydroxyl group, allow it to participate in a wide range of chemical reactions. Researchers and formulators often seek this compound when developing complex molecules, pharmaceuticals, or specialized fine chemicals. Furthermore, the applications extend beyond basic synthesis. The compound’s functional groups make it a valuable component in the creation of dyes, pigments, and potentially other industrial additives. Its role as a versatile intermediate means that its importance in the chemical industry is likely to grow as new applications are discovered.
